What Are Toddler Cardigans
Toddler cardigans are front-opening sweaters designed specifically for children aged 12 months to 4 years. These garments feature buttons, zippers, or snap closures that make dressing easier for parents and caregivers.
Unlike pullover sweaters, cardigans offer versatile layering options that adapt to temperature changes throughout the day. The open-front design allows for quick adjustments without completely removing the garment, making them practical for active toddlers who play both indoors and outdoors.
How Toddler Cardigans Work for Daily Wear
Toddler cardigans function as transitional clothing pieces that bridge the gap between light and heavy outerwear. Parents can easily add or remove them as temperatures fluctuate during daily activities.
The button or zip closure system allows caregivers to dress children quickly, especially important during busy morning routines. Many designs feature stretchy materials that accommodate rapid growth spurts common in toddlers. The layering capability means children stay comfortable whether moving from air-conditioned spaces to outdoor play areas.

Benefits and Drawbacks of Toddler Cardigans
Key benefits include easy temperature regulation, simple dressing process, and style versatility for various occasions. Cardigans work well for school, playdates, and family outings without requiring complete outfit changes.
However, potential drawbacks include buttons that may pose choking hazards for very young children, and the tendency for active toddlers to unbutton or unzip cardigans during play. Some designs may require more careful washing due to delicate materials or decorative elements that could snag or fade.
Pricing Overview for Toddler Cardigans
Toddler cardigan prices typically range from budget to mid-range categories depending on brand, materials, and construction quality. Basic cotton blends from discount retailers start at lower price points, while premium organic or specialty fiber options command higher prices.
Seasonal sales often provide opportunities for significant savings, particularly during end-of-season clearances. Many retailers offer multi-piece sets that include cardigans with matching pants or shirts, potentially providing better value than individual purchases. Parents should consider cost-per-wear when evaluating options, as higher-quality pieces often withstand frequent washing and active play better than lower-priced alternatives.
